Home Opener Ends W/ Tough Loss

Nolan Sutker
The KUA golf team was back in action on Friday as they had their home opener against Vermont Academy. #1 Taylor Millward shot 37 but lost his match on the 8th hole to the streaky VA #1 player who posted a 34. #2 Michael Novey had an opportunity on the last hole to half his match and secure a full point in the duo's best ball match but had an untimely double on the final hole to just lose his match and half the best ball. Next, the french connection Gabe Veillieux and Martin Ouellette manned the #3 and #4 spots respectively with Gabe posting a 40 for nine holes and securing both his and the best ball match. With the match closely contested, the final foursome would decide the outcome. #5 Zach Musgrave missed a tough putt from two feet on the 8th hole to just miss beating his opponent, he shot 40 for nine holes and secured a half point. Next, scrappy and determined #6 Sam Hermann missed a putt from a similar length on the 8th and was one down going to the ninth. He found a way to win the hole and secure a half point. The best ball match was also halved, meaning KUA would come up just short of a win, losing 5 to 4. The team continues to improve and is looking forward to their rematch with Tilton tomorrow at Hanover.
